    Ioniq 5: The Retro-Futuristic Star

    The Hyundai Ioniq 5 continues to be a standout model in the electric vehicle market, and for good reason. Its retro-futuristic design is a head-turner, combining classic hatchback elements with a modern, minimalist aesthetic. But it's not just about looks; the Ioniq 5 packs a serious punch in terms of performance and technology. The 2024 model boasts impressive range, making it perfect for both city commutes and longer road trips. Depending on the configuration, you can expect a range of over 300 miles on a single charge. Plus, with its ultra-fast charging capabilities, you can add significant range in just a matter of minutes at a compatible charging station. The Ioniq 5's interior is equally impressive, featuring a spacious and comfortable cabin with sustainable materials. The dual-screen setup provides a seamless and intuitive user experience, offering access to navigation, entertainment, and vehicle settings. With advanced driver-assistance systems like lane-keeping assist, adaptive cruise control, and automatic emergency braking, the Ioniq 5 prioritizes safety on the road.     Nexo: The Hydrogen Fuel Cell Vehicle

    While not a battery-electric vehicle, the Hyundai Nexo deserves a mention as it represents Hyundai's commitment to alternative fuel technologies. The Nexo is a hydrogen fuel cell vehicle, which means it runs on hydrogen gas and emits only water vapor as exhaust. It's an incredibly clean and efficient way to travel, and Hyundai is one of the leaders in this technology. The Nexo offers a long driving range, similar to that of a gasoline-powered car, and it can be refueled in just a matter of minutes at a hydrogen fueling station. The interior of the Nexo is luxurious and comfortable, with plenty of space for passengers and cargo. It's equipped with a range of advanced technology features, including a large touchscreen display, a premium sound system, and a suite of driver-assistance systems. One of the unique features of the Nexo is its ability to purify the air as it drives. The fuel cell system filters out pollutants from the air, making it cleaner for everyone. While hydrogen fueling infrastructure is still limited in many areas, the Nexo represents a promising future for zero-emission transportation.     Charging and Infrastructure

    One of the key considerations when switching to an electric vehicle is charging. Fortunately, Hyundai has made it easier than ever to charge your EV, whether you're at home or on the road. All of Hyundai's electric models are compatible with both Level 2 and DC fast charging. Level 2 charging is typically done at home or at public charging stations and can fully charge your EV in a matter of hours. DC fast charging, on the other hand, can add significant range in just a matter of minutes, making it ideal for long road trips. Hyundai has partnered with several charging networks to provide its customers with access to a wide range of charging stations across the country. Through the MyHyundai app, you can easily locate nearby charging stations, check their availability, and even pay for your charging session. In addition to public charging, Hyundai also offers home charging solutions. You can purchase a Level 2 charger for your home, allowing you to conveniently charge your EV overnight.
